Dish launches music channel Palladia HD

by hdreport on June 30, 2010

Dish Network has launched music channel Palladia in both standard-def and high-definition (HD) for customers who subscribe to the America’s Top 200 service package or higher level package. Subscribers to the Top 200 will now get Palladia instead of Fuse. Full Story

Green Day Live at the Fox Theatre broadcast in HD

by Jeffrey Nukom on May 29, 2010

HDNet will present “Green Day Live at the Fox Theatre” this Sunday, May 30 at 8:30 p.m. Eastern Time. A premiere for the network, the concert is in support of their album “21st Century Breakdown,” which won the Grammy for Best Rock Album this year. Full Story

U2’s Rosebowl concert to release on Blu-ray

by Jeff Chabot on March 31, 2010

This news came as a pleasant surprise as I was one of the 100,000 attending the concert in the fall of ‘09 and didn’t realize it was being filmed for Blu-ray release. “U2360 At The Rose Bowl” was U2’s biggest show yet in the States, selling out the Rose Bowl in Pasadena, CA in support of the group’s No Line on The Horizon album. Interactive network ‘Havoc’ added to DirecTV

by Jeff Chabot on December 18, 2008

Havoc network is now available in HD on DirecTV’s channel 101. The network airs an interactive jukebox which viewers can interact with by texting messages that appear on screen. Havoc’s programming currently consists of videos focused on indie music and action sports. Full Story
